olt: add bulk DHCPv4/DHCPv6 filter edit alongside flood mode

Generalises the OLT bulk tool from flood-mode-only to arbitrary NNI-service
edits. DHCP modes live nested under each NNI entry's Filter object
(Filter.DHCPv4 / Filter.DHCPv6, e.g. "pass" <-> "umt"), confirmed from a
real OLT-CFG paste-back.

- src/mcms-api.js: planFloodChange -> planNniEdit(oltCfg, {tagPattern, flood,
  dhcpv4, dhcpv6}); each concern optional. DHCP is value-replacement,
  replace-only-when-present (never invents the key; leaves EAPOL/PPPoE/NDP).
  Still non-mutating (clones the entry AND the Filter). Returns changes with
  per-entry edits[]. summarizeOltNniNetworks surfaces dhcpv4/dhcpv6; new
  dhcpModeOfNni helper.
- main.js + web/server.js: executeFloodChange handler passes flood/dhcpv4/
  dhcpv6 ops through (channel name kept for wire compat).
- renderer: OLT inspector now has three action dropdowns (Flooding / DHCPv4 /
  DHCPv6, defaults flood private->auto + DHCP pass->umt); table shows DHCP
  chips + per-service "will change (flood, DHCPv4, …)"; flood-mode filter
  defaults to Any so DHCP-on-pass auto-flood OLTs still show; CSV report
  lists every per-NNI edit (pon-olt-nni-*.csv).

Verified: node --check; planNniEdit unit-tested against the real fixture +
a pass variant (13/13: no-mutation, EAPOL/PPPoE/NDP preserved,
replace-when-present, flood/DHCP independence); OLT view rendered offscreen
showing correct per-service "will change" markers.

// DHCP relay/filter mode for an NNI entry. On Tibit OLTs these live under a
// nested `Filter` object alongside EAPOL/PPPoE/NDP, e.g.
// "Filter": { "DHCPv4": "umt", "DHCPv6": "umt", "EAPOL": "pass", ... }
// `ver` is 'DHCPv4' | 'DHCPv6'. Returns the value (e.g. "umt" / "pass") or
// null if there is no Filter or the key is absent.
function dhcpModeOfNni(nniNet, ver) {
const filter = nniNet && typeof nniNet.Filter === 'object' && nniNet.Filter ? nniNet.Filter : null;
if (!filter) return null;
return Object.prototype.hasOwnProperty.call(filter, ver) ? filter[ver] : null;
}
